It doesn’t require any kind of toys, anything along the lines of ‘sploshing’ or anything particularly kinky. I mean, it doesn’t even require much flexibility. All the Kivin method needs is a change of angle.

It requires a slight change of angle. (Getty Stock Photo)
It requires a slight change of angle. (Getty Stock Photo)

So, this one’s specifically for those of you performing cunnilingus, an act that would typically see you face on or kneeling down in front.

Or maybe you’re being sat on or doing the 69, but the Kivin method is so much simpler and supposedly, far more pleasurable.

Essentially, the giver is to be perpendicular to receiver, maybe even under a leg if you’re that way inclined.

The giver can just slide under that raised knee, aligning their mouth with the receiver’s vulva.

It’s said coming from this angle will allow easier access to other parts of the receiver’s genitals as well as even less neck strain.

“It can be pretty orgasmic for a lot of us,” one expert said on TikTok as another joked: “Milk that bad boy and she will sploosh.”

Clinical sexologist Stefani Goerlich added to Women’s Health: “The Kivin method positions the giver to access more of the vulva, clitoris, and perineum in a way that’s often far more comfortable.”

It should apparently induce more intense pleasure. (Getty Stock)
It should apparently induce more intense pleasure. (Getty Stock)

And certified sex therapist Mandi Long added: “Because of the sideways angle, people with vulvas can experience more intense pleasure and orgasm—with most reporting orgasm within 10 minutes, and some reporting orgasm in as little as two to three minutes.”

The Kivin method can apparently also be a little better who find the usual cunnilingus to be too intense as Goerlich claimed: “The shift in positioning can lighten [the impact on] the clitoris in a way that feels pleasurable without being overwhelming.”
